Understanding the Importance of OEM Stainless Steel Agitator Tanks in Metallurgy and Energy Industries

Stainless steel is known for its durability and corrosion resistance. In industries where harsh chemicals and high temperatures are prevalent, having equipment that can withstand such conditions is vital. OEM stainless steel agitator tanks not only resist corrosion but are also easy to clean and maintain, which is essential for adhering to regulatory standards and ensuring product purity. This is particularly important in processes involving metals and minerals, where contamination can compromise the quality of the final product.
One of the primary functions of an agitator tank is to ensure homogenous mixing of materials. This is essential in processes such as chemical reactions, where uniformity can affect the outcome and efficiency of the reaction. The design of the agitator, combined with the tank's size and shape, can significantly influence the mixing efficiency. Customization options are often available to cater to specific process requirements, making OEM stainless steel agitator tanks a versatile solution for various applications.
In addition to their functional benefits, these tanks also contribute to energy efficiency. Properly designed agitator tanks can reduce energy consumption by optimizing mixing times and minimizing the need for additional equipment. This not only lowers operational costs but also supports sustainability initiatives, as industries increasingly seek to reduce their carbon footprint.
Furthermore, the use of OEM stainless steel agitator tanks can enhance safety in the workplace. Their robust design minimizes the risk of leaks and spills, protecting workers and the environment. Incorporating advanced safety features, such as pressure relief valves and easy access for maintenance, contributes to a safer working environment.
